Solution for 2(5c+1)-16=8c+2 equation:


Simplifying
2(5c + 1) + -16 = 8c + 2

Reorder the terms:
2(1 + 5c) + -16 = 8c + 2
(1 * 2 + 5c * 2) + -16 = 8c + 2
(2 + 10c) + -16 = 8c + 2

Reorder the terms:
2 + -16 + 10c = 8c + 2

Combine like terms: 2 + -16 = -14
-14 + 10c = 8c + 2

Reorder the terms:
-14 + 10c = 2 + 8c

Solving
-14 + 10c = 2 + 8c

Solving for variable 'c'.

Move all terms containing c to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-8c' to each side of the equation.
-14 + 10c + -8c = 2 + 8c + -8c

Combine like terms: 10c + -8c = 2c
-14 + 2c = 2 + 8c + -8c

Combine like terms: 8c + -8c = 0
-14 + 2c = 2 + 0
-14 + 2c = 2

Add '14' to each side of the equation.
-14 + 14 + 2c = 2 + 14

Combine like terms: -14 + 14 = 0
0 + 2c = 2 + 14
2c = 2 + 14

Combine like terms: 2 + 14 = 16
2c = 16

Divide each side by '2'.
c = 8

Simplifying
c = 8
